NORTH ATLANTIC TREATY ORGANISATION’S TENTH ANNIVERSARY.—Photographs taken on April 7 at the Supreme Headquarters of the Allied Powers in Europe. Louveciennes, France. LEFT: The Supreme Commander (General L. Norstad) welcoming the Vice-President of the United States (Mr Lyndon Johnson). RIGHT: A feature of the anniversary celebrations. Representatives of the member countries parade in national uniforms.
